Why is such an effort needed? For many years New York led the way in protecting children and providing funding for their needs. That is no longer the case. Although there have been some advances, many children continue to live in less than satisfactory conditions.

Did you know that Buffalo’s poverty rate of 31.5% is nearly tied with New Orleans (32.4%)? New York City is not far behind with a rate of 28%. In addition, the National Center for Children in Poverty estimates that 9.6% of New York’s children are living in extreme poverty, a ranking of 8th in the country. And, New York State is ranked 20th in the United States on Kids Count’s 10 measures of children’s well-being. Too many children go without health insurance, quality early care and education, or wind up dropping out of school.
